SHANK3 mutations are likely to cause mitochondrial dysfunction in PMS because six mitochondrial genes, including NADH dehydrogenase 1 alpha subcomplex subunit 6 (NDUFA6 ), cytochrome c oxidase assembly ( SCO2 ), tRNA 5-methylaminomethyl-2-thiouridylate methyltransferase ( TRMU ), thymidine phosphorylase ( TYMP ), carnitine palmitoyltransferase 1B ( CPT1B ), and aconitase 2 ( ACO2 ), are adjacent to SHANK3 in the 22q13.3 region [339]

Management of associated conditions is essential: Diabetes control : Pioglitazone and GLP-1 receptor agonists (such as liraglutide or semaglutide) show hepatic benefits in clinical trials, but their use for NASH is off-label in the UK and should be initiated and monitored by specialists after careful riskbenefit discussion
